A Job Site Is Not a Finished Building

Construction site security solves a problem that fixed-property security never encounters: the site is a different place every month. Fencing moves. Gates relocate. A staging yard that held nothing in March holds a season's worth of copper by June. The patrol contract someone signed in week one describes a property that stopped existing around week twenty.

Everything worth taking is portable and sitting outdoors. Wire, lumber, rebar, fuel, generators, compressors, hand tools. Little of it is marked in a way that helps you afterward, and most of it converts to cash the same day it leaves. The timing is no mystery either. Sites empty at the same hour each evening, and through a Washington winter that hour arrives in darkness and the darkness holds for sixteen hours.

Then there is the question of who belongs on site. On a busy build, nobody at the gate could answer that with real confidence on any given Tuesday. Trades cycle through, inspectors turn up unannounced, deliveries land ahead of schedule. Coverage that cannot separate a legitimate crew from someone walking in behind one is not doing the job. Common Security Challenges on Washington Construction Sites

Heavy Equipment

Machines sit where the work left them, and a loader is on a trailer in under ten minutes.

Staged Material

Copper and wire disappear first, because they resell fastest and trace slowest.

Fuel and Fluids

Tanks get siphoned in silence, and one cut hydraulic line idles a crew for a shift.

Perimeter Breaches

A cut in temporary fencing turns up in the morning, long after it mattered.

Vandalism

Graffiti and broken glass cost far less to repair than they cost in schedule.

Unscreened Entry

Someone walks on behind a delivery, and nothing in writing says they should not have.

What Poor Coverage Costs a Contractor

The replacement invoice for a stolen compressor is the smallest number in the incident. The larger figures are the pour that did not happen, the crew standing around waiting on it, the rental you paid for in the meantime, and the float you no longer have between today and a liquidated damages date.

A reputational cost sits behind all of that, and it lands on the general contractor. Owners notice which builders lose things. Insurers notice which sites file claims.
